Transaction d9579312f3c17ad0e72f9c60b15f91d26481c95dac0ec110db164f52fdabad07

block
b089f5e5a23e8c64c735a61135169cc056d2b2974b548048466895a7d5149dd3

1 Input

1501 Outputs